Barnie Leads Acre Fund Delegation to Nasarawa State, Sets Sight on 1 Million Free Tree Distribution (Photos)

Mr. Barnie Egbon leads a delegation from One Acre Fund to meet with Nasarawa State Commissioner of Environment and Mineral Resources, Hon. Kwanta Yakubu, ahead of the 1 million free tree distribution to 30,000 farmers.

In a bid to strengthen partnerships and promote sustainable farming practices, Barnie Egbon, leading a delegation from One Acre Fund’s Government Relations and Partnerships Team, met with Hon. Kwanta Yakubu, Nasarawa State Commissioner of Environment and Mineral Resources.

The meeting comes ahead of the 1 million free tree distribution to 30,000 farmers across three Local Government Areas (LGAs) in Nasarawa State, starting this July. One Acre Fund has established 51 tree nurseries across Lafia, Nasarawa Eggon, and Obi LGAs, raising over 1 million seedlings for distribution.

This initiative is part of One Acre Fund’s larger goal to distribute 6 million free trees to 220,000 farmers in Nasarawa, Niger, and Kwara states in 2024. In 2023, the organization successfully distributed 2.5 million trees to 110,000 farmers in Niger state.
